Ansley Alumni Field

Ansley Alumni Field is a full size Fédération Internationale de Football Association (FIFA) sized soccer pitch and full size World Rugby pitch. Located on the East side of Waterloo campus off King Street North, Ansley Alumni Field is home to a variety of intramural sport leagues, varsity teams including Soccer and Lacrosse, and is available for rental groups.

The turf field features 280 permanent seats, a press box with three separately enclosed rooms for home and visiting team coaches and spotters, and an open concept area for print media, radio broadcasts, webcasting, and game operations staff. The press box also has controls for the Daktronics LED scoreboard, and sound system. 

The 4.7 million upgrade was made possible thanks to principal gifts from the Wilfrid Laurier University Student’s Union, Wilfrid Laurier Graduate Students’ Association, and the Wilfrid Laurier Alumni Association. The enhancements increased the footprint of the largest greenspace on Laurier’s Waterloo campus. Work began in June 2022 and was completed by spring 2023.
